On 3 Tammuz 5770, Mareches Haoros Ubiurim Oholei Torah under the direction of Reb Avrohom Gerlitzky will publish the 1000th issue of Kovetz Haoros Ubiurim.
Kovetz Haoros Ubiruim began in the year 5740 and has been published weekly / bi-weekly ever since. The Rebbe would often devote whole portions of his sichos to discuss issues brought up in that week’s kovetz.
